Internal Temperature Guide
The internal temperature of cooked salmon can be measured using a food thermometer. The following guide provides a general outline of the internal temperatures for cooked salmon:
- 120°F – 130°F (49°C – 54°C): Rare, with a pink and tender interior
- 130°F – 135°F (54°C – 57°C): Medium-rare, with a slightly firmer interior
- 135°F – 140°F (57°C – 60°C): Medium, with a cooked-through interior and a hint of pink
- 140°F – 145°F (60°C – 63°C): Medium-well, with a fully cooked interior and a slightly dry texture
- 145°F (63°C) or above: Well-done, with a fully cooked and potentially dry interior

Flaking and Texture
A key visual cue for doneness is the flaking and texture of the salmon. When cooked to the right temperature, salmon will flake easily with a fork, and the flesh will be tender and moist. If the salmon is undercooked, it will be dense and rubbery, while overcooked salmon will be dry and crumbly.

Pan-Seared Salmon
Pan-searing is a popular cooking method for salmon, as it allows for a crispy exterior and a tender interior. To pan-sear salmon, heat a skillet over medium-high heat, add a small amount of oil, and cook the salmon for 3-4 minutes per side, or until it reaches the desired internal temperature.
Grilled Salmon
Grilling is another popular cooking method for salmon, as it allows for a smoky flavor and a crispy exterior. To grill salmon, preheat the grill to medium-high heat, season the salmon with your desired spices and herbs, and cook for 4-6 minutes per side, or until it reaches the desired internal temperature.

How do I check the internal temperature of salmon to ensure it’s cooked to a safe temperature?
To check the internal temperature of salmon, you’ll need a food thermometer, which can be either digital or analog. When inserting the thermometer, make sure to avoid any bones or fat, as this can give an inaccurate reading. Insert the thermometer into the thickest part of the salmon, usually at an angle, and wait for a few seconds until the temperature stabilizes. It’s essential to calibrate your thermometer before use to ensure accuracy. You can calibrate your thermometer by submerging it in a bowl of ice water and adjusting the reading to 32°F (0°C).
The recommended internal temperature for cooked salmon is at least 145°F (63°C). If you’re cooking salmon to a lower temperature, such as for sashimi or sushi, it’s crucial to handle and store the fish safely to prevent foodborne illness. When checking the internal temperature, make sure to insert the thermometer into the thickest part of the salmon, as this will give the most accurate reading. If you don’t have a thermometer, you can also check the doneness of salmon by using the flake test, where you insert a fork into the thickest part of the salmon and twist it gently. If the salmon flakes easily, it’s likely cooked to a safe temperature.
What are the different ways to cook salmon, and how do they affect the doneness?
There are several ways to cook salmon, including grilling, baking, pan-searing, and poaching. Each method can affect the doneness of the salmon, as well as its texture and flavor. Grilling and pan-searing can create a crispy crust on the outside, while baking and poaching can result in a more delicate texture. The cooking time and temperature will also vary depending on the method, so it’s essential to adjust the cooking time accordingly. For example, grilling salmon will require a higher heat and shorter cooking time than baking.
The cooking method can also affect the internal temperature of the salmon. For example, grilling or pan-searing can create a crust on the outside that may be overcooked, while the inside remains undercooked. On the other hand, baking or poaching can result in a more even cooking temperature throughout the salmon. To ensure the salmon is cooked to a safe temperature, it’s crucial to use a thermometer, especially when trying a new cooking method. Additionally, make sure to not overcrowd the pan or cooking surface, as this can affect the cooking time and temperature, leading to undercooked or overcooked salmon.
Can I cook salmon to a medium-rare or medium temperature, or is it necessary to cook it to well-done?
While it’s possible to cook salmon to a medium-rare or medium temperature, it’s essential to consider the risk of foodborne illness. Salmon, like other fish, can contain parasites and bacteria that can cause illness if not cooked to a safe temperature. The recommended internal temperature for cooked salmon is at least 145°F (63°C), which is considered well-done. Cooking salmon to a medium-rare or medium temperature can increase the risk of foodborne illness, especially for vulnerable populations such as the elderly, pregnant women, and young children.
However, if you still want to cook salmon to a medium-rare or medium temperature, it’s crucial to handle and store the fish safely to minimize the risk of foodborne illness. Make sure to purchase salmon from a reputable source, and store it in the refrigerator at a temperature of 40°F (4°C) or below. When cooking, use a thermometer to ensure the internal temperature reaches at least 120°F (49°C) for medium-rare or 130°F (54°C) for medium. It’s also essential to cook the salmon immediately after thawing, and to not let it sit at room temperature for an extended period.
